Latest Patents

Mineo Fukui holds a patent for an on-vehicle human sensing switch. This invention includes a display that luminously presents a switch image for a vehicle-mounted electronic device. The design features a light transmission type touch panel substrate body placed on the display, along with a light transmission type decorative body. The touch panel substrate incorporates an electrostatic capacitance type sensor electrode that detects the approach of a detection target, as well as a switch electrode that identifies actions from the detection target. When the sensor detects the target's approach, the switch image is displayed, enhancing the interaction between the user and the vehicle's electronic systems.
